java 位运算符!
java支持的位运算符有7个,分为两类:位逻辑运算和移位运算。位逻辑运算符包括按位取反(~)、按位与(&)、按位或(
)和按位异或(^)4种,。移位运算符包括左移(«)、右移(»)和无符号右移(»>)3种。位运算符只能用于整型数据,包括byte、short、int、long和char类型。下表列出了各种位运算符的功能与示例。假设a = 10, b = 3。
~运算符是对运算数的每一位按位取反。
下表列出了位运算符的基本运算,假设整数变量A的值为60和变量B的值为13:
操作符
描述
例子
&
如果相对应位都是1,则结果为1...
25 post articles, 4 pages.